1. A telescopic gun sight for sighting an image of an object, comprising:

  • a housing comprising an objective end and an eyepiece end;

    an objective lens positioned within said objective end, said objective lens operable to receive light from the object and focus the image of the object at an image plane positioned between said objective and eyepiece ends;

    an inverting tube positioned between said image plane and said eyepiece end for inverting the object image;

    an ocular lens positioned within said eyepiece end for presenting the inverted object image for viewing;

    a primary reticule positioned between said ocular lens and said inverting tube, said primary reticule including sighting insignia imprinted thereon; and

    a secondary reticule positioned between said inverting tube and said objective lens, said secondary reticule being movable both horizontally and vertically in said image plane independent of said inverting tube, said secondary reticule comprising a generally horizontal windage correction scale operative to provide instant windage correction target alignment, said windage correction scale comprising a plurality of instant windage correction target alignment values positioned at point-specific spaced-apart locations on said windage correction scale, wherein each instant windage correction target alignment value corresponds with a selected distance calculated for a selected bullet type, bullet weight, and wind speed, said windage correction scale eliminating the need to calculate the horizontal deflection of a bullet due to wind and the minutes of angle corresponding to the horizontal deflection.
